当前位置:首页 > 问答 > 正文

时间精度|毫秒丢失 mysql存储时间为什么没有毫秒级别

🔍 :

时间精度|毫秒丢失 mysql存储时间为什么没有毫秒级别

  1. 时间精度问题 ⏱️
  2. MySQL时间类型 🗄️(如 DATETIMETIMESTAMP
  3. 毫秒丢失原因 ❌(默认精度仅到秒)
  4. 高精度存储方案 💡(如 DATETIME(3) 支持毫秒)
  5. 版本差异 🔄(MySQL 5.6+ 支持小数秒)
  6. 应用场景需求 ⚙️(日志、金融交易需毫秒)
  7. 隐式截断警告 ⚠️(插入毫秒时自动舍入)

📌 补充说明

时间精度|毫秒丢失 mysql存储时间为什么没有毫秒级别

  • 旧版MySQL(如5.5)默认不支持毫秒,需升级或改用 BIGINT 存储时间戳 ✨
  • 示例语法:CREATE TABLE events (log_time DATETIME(6)); (微秒级)

发表评论